## Releases

Hey on-call: PaperFerry (the spooler microservice) ships every other Tuesday. If you're cutting a hotfix at 3 a.m., tag from main, run the queue-drain test, and don't skip the canary — printers are grumpy. Hotfix images must be signed before the Dockline registry will accept them, using the key below.

rollout seal: bky4_x7Gc

### Undo & Redo

Every mutation your plugin makes in the Sketchloom canvas should go through the history API — that way users get undo and redo for free, and your changes batch cleanly with theirs. To test history replay against the Loomcore staging service, authenticate with the key below.

service key, tadup-yagep: kto23_Eoog5Djh7wQNnUcbvpYZZfG

Subject: Catalogue import on-call notes

Welcome to the rotation, and thanks for covering this week. The Lanternwell library catalogue import runs nightly at 02:00; if it stalls, check the Shelfmark queue before restarting anything, since partial imports can duplicate records. Full triage steps, including rollback guidance, are documented on the internal page here:

dashboard of kawip-kajep = https://jira.qorvellabs.internal/display/browse/projects/projects/a194

Handover — Vexler partner SFTP drop

Ownership moves to you today. Drop runs hourly from Vexler's end into the intake bucket via the relay host. Watch for zero-byte files; their exporter flakes on Mondays. Creds live in the ops vault, path noted in the runbook. Vault auto-seals after 48h idle. Support escalations go to the on-call rotation, not me. If the vault is sealed when you need it, unseal with the recovery passphrase below.

recovery phrase for tadug-fafof: zorwyn-kasion

## Support

Stormfan handles fan-out of weather alerts from the Galehaven ingest service to downstream subscribers. Security reviewers: threat model and data-flow diagrams live in the docs directory; signing keys rotate quarterly via the Keywright service. Do not open public issues for vulnerabilities in the fan-out path or subscriber authentication. Report all suspected security flaws privately to the disclosure contact below.

billing contact of baweg-bahif = kelmir_prair_eliael@nelvroworks.internal